EDUCATION NEWS

  • Melissa Morris of Cypress Elementary was named Shasta County’s 2026 School Counselor of the Year by the Shasta County Office of Education today at 3:30 a.m. PT for her innovative, data-driven methods that include co-founding a Kindness Club and creating a Sensory Room.  Record Searchlight

ENVIRONMENT NEWS

  • Prescribed burns will begin today in the Shasta-Trinity National Forest to reduce wildfire risk; drivers along I-5 north of Redding and nearby areas should expect smoke and possible road closures. Officials will monitor weather through Feb. 13 to ensure safe burns — follow posted signs for updates.  Record Searchlight

SPORTS NEWS

  • Chico High’s boys and girls wrestling teams won the Eastern Athletic League championships on Feb. 7 at Shasta High School. The boys scored 187.5 and the girls earned 177 points, marking six individual first-place finishes for Chico.  Record Searchlight
